Repeating a section within a title/track

 

You can repeat the playback of a specific segment 

within a title or track. To do this, you must mark the 

start and end of the segment you want. 

A

 

While playing a disc, press A - B at your chosen 

starting point.

B

 

Press A - B again at your chosen end point.

  

 The section will now repeat continuously.

C

 

To exit the sequence, press A - B.

Changing the Audio Language

 

For DVD

 

Press AUDIO repeatedly to select different audio 

languages.

 

Changing the Audio Channel

 

For VCD

  

Press AUDIO to select the available audio channels 

provided by the disc (Left, Right, Mix, Stereo).

 

Subtitles

  

Press  SUBTITLE  repeatedly  to  select  different 

subtitle languages.

Press PREV 

 / NEXT 

 to go to the previous 

or next track.

  

When PREV  

 is pressed after the 5 seconds 

of playback, playback will start from the beginning of 

the current track. If you press the button within the 5 

seconds, playback will start from the beginning of the 

preceding track.

  

During playback, pressing RETURN will return to 

the menu screen (if PBC is on).
